Gideon’s Light Cruiser- Nanoscale
The latest addition to my nanoscale fleet is a Class 546 cruiser, most notable for being Moff Gideon’s flagship. As with the rest of the fleet, this ship is to-scale with the 75252 UCS Imperial Star Destroyer (1:1455 scale, or approximately 11.64 meters per stud). The class 546 is about 50% larger than the more common Arquiten’s class cruiser, at 381 meters long, which means this model comes in at just over 32 studs long. This also makes it the largest of the nanoscale ships I’ve made so far.
